THIS CYCLE'S PROMPTS
#1 A naughty Castform is following people around and causing rain wherever they walk. Talk about spring showers!
#2 The Flower Grove is well-known for its spring blossoms. Your character has gone to visit, only to discover Gloom have moved in to enjoy the pleasant fragrance! And now the pleasant fragrance...isn't.
#3 This baby Pidgey has fallen out of its nest!!! What do you do? Do you get help? It's squawking and flapping like nobody's business. Might be hard to hang onto without somebody else around to spot you...
#4 Glacier is excited for the Big Spring Thaw! They will tell this to anyone who comes to see them at Citadel, and will even lead expeditions up to the Obsidian Flats to show off the lovely warm weather......while it's still snowing.
#5 Union is still repairing itself after Kyurem's attack. Construction workers are needed at this site. Humans and Pokémon are both welcome, but the supervisor is a Machoke. Communication could get tricky.
#6 Wildcard! Come up with your own prompt!
